diff --git a/common/fragments/graphical/polybar.nix b/common/fragments/graphical/polybar.nix index 7e388c7..3ee0cff 100644 --- a/common/fragments/graphical/polybar.nix +++ b/common/fragments/graphical/polybar.nix @@ -20,6 +20,9 @@ in { Install = { WantedBy = [ "graphical-session.target" ]; }; }; + xdg.configFile."polybar/config.ini".onChange = + "${pkgs.systemd}/bin/systemctl --user restart polybar.service"; + services.polybar = { enable = true; package = pkgs.polybarFull;